Method
Burger Patties
Mix and form patties
Place ground beef in a bowl. Add salt, pepper and Worcestershire sauce. Gently mix with your hands until just combined; do not overwork. Divide into 2 equal portions and form into patties about 4.5 inches (11 cm) across and roughly 3/4 inch (2 cm) thick, making a slight dimple in the center of each patty with your thumb to prevent puffing while cooking.
Bacon & Cheese
Cook the bacon
In a separate skillet over medium heat, lay the bacon strips in a single layer and cook until crisp around the edges but still slightly chewy, about 6–8 minutes, flipping occasionally. Transfer to a paper towel-lined plate to drain. For extra smoky flavor, cook slightly longer until crisp to your preference.
Cook patties and melt cheese
Place the formed patties on the hot skillet or grill. Cook undisturbed for 3–4 minutes until a brown crust forms. Flip and cook the second side 2–3 minutes for medium (internal temp ~140–145°F / 60–63°C). During the last minute of cooking, place two cheddar slices on each patty and cover the pan or close the grill lid to melt the cheese, about 30–60 seconds.
Buns & Toppings
Assemble burgers
Spread 1 tbsp mayonnaise on the bottom half of each bun and 1/2 tsp mustard on the top half. Place a lettuce leaf on the mayo, then the cheese-topped patty, top each patty with two slices of cooked bacon, 2 pickle slices, tomato slice, and a few rings of red onion. Cap with the top bun.
Serve
Let assembled burgers rest 1–2 minutes to allow juices to settle, then serve immediately while hot.
